BAT文件执行后有中文乱码

其实造成这个问题的原因很简单。

编辑批处理文件时,以ANSI方式编辑即可。若以别的方式(如UTF-8)编辑了批处理,转换成ANSI格式即可。

windows自带的记事本保存文件时即可选择编码方式

 

例如修改hosts文件,

echo 192.168.11.1 www.baidu.com >> ‪C:\Windows\System32\drivers\etc\hosts

保存的时候用记事本打开,并另存为ANSI格式

posted @ 2020-11-19 11:04  范若若  阅读(375)  评论(0编辑  收藏  举报